    10. Cedar City Regional Airport The airport has two runways; the second largest public runway in the state as well as a cross wind runway. Equipped with the latest navigational aids: precision instrument approach (ILS), VOR Approach, and GPS approach, Cedar City is the best place to earn your instrument rating.
    11. Local Area The Cedar City flight practice areas is over 50 square miles in area, just a short distance from the airport, creating a safe and effective training arena. The Cedar City Regional airport is currently un-towered, making it a premier flight training airport as more of your money is spent in the air rather than waiting for a takeoff clearance. Towered airports are closely located in Las Vegas, Provo, and Salt Lake City where you can enhance your flight experience.
    12. Surrounding Area While learning to fly at Western Wings Flight School you will be enjoying some of the best scenery that the Rocky Mountains have to offer. At 5,622 ft above sea level Cedar City is located close to Zion’s National Park, Cedar Breaks, and Bryce Canyon, with Lake Powell recreational area and the Grand Canyon just a short flight away.
    13. Take a Discovery Flight. Western Wings Flight School offers you the opportunity to experience the excitement of flying without any commitment. Our $60 Discovery flight is a great opportunity to explore aviation for yourself or a great gift for an aspiring pilot, or simply someone who loves aviation. During your Discovery flight, a flight instructor will be sitting beside you with another set of flight controls, but you’ll be in the pilot’s seat! This is your first flight lesson, and you’ll see what it’s like to visually inspect the aircraft before flight, take off, fly, land, park, and shutdown! Although the flight instructor will perform the landing, depending on your comfort level you will be doing most of the flying including the take-off. You’ll fly the most popular training airplane, the Cessna 172. Your flight will last about 30 minutes and you can even log that time in a logbook so it counts toward the required flight time for your private pilot certificate! Please plan on being at the airport for at least 2 hours so that you have time to ask the instructor and course adviser any questions you may have, and mostly just to sit back in our pilot lounge and discuss the joy of your first flight with others.
